Principles for using surrogate loss functions to approximate complex objectives while maintaining optimization tractability.
Surrogate losses offer practical pathways to optimize intricate objectives by balancing fidelity, tractability, and robustness, enabling scalable learning in real-world systems through principled approximation, calibration, and validation strategies.
Published July 31, 2025
Facebook X Reddit Pinterest Email
Surrogate loss functions are a practical tool in machine learning that help translate difficult optimization problems into more tractable forms. When the objective involves nonconvexity, discontinuities, or costly evaluations, surrogates provide smooth, differentiable proxies that guide learning without demanding exact adherence to the original target. The choice of surrogate is critical: it must align with the ultimate evaluation metric, preserve essential ordering or ranking properties, and remain computationally efficient. By design, a good surrogate reduces variance, controls bias, and facilitates gradient-based optimization. In practice, engineers select surrogates that balance fidelity to the true objective with the realities of data scale, algorithmic speed, and resource constraints.
A principled surrogate strategy begins with clearly defining the core objective and the downstream metric that matters for decision making. Once the target is identified, analysts translate it into a surrogate that mimics key behaviors while smoothing irregularities that hamper convergence. This requires a careful calibration phase where hyperparameters govern the trade-off between approximation accuracy and computational tractability. Validation must extend beyond simple loss minimization and include alignment checks with actual performance on held-out data, domain-expert feedback, and sensitivity analyses to avoid overfitting to the surrogate structure. The payoff is a robust learning process that remains faithful to real-world goals under changing conditions.
Designing surrogates that stay faithful under shift and scale.
Surrogate losses work best when they preserve monotonic signals that matter for ranking or decision boundaries. If the surrogate distorts orderings critical to outcomes, then improvements on the surrogate may not translate into gains on the actual objective. Therefore, practitioners assess the surrogate’s alignment by comparing pairwise relationships, thresholds, or risk buckets as custody checks before deployment. A common approach is to frame the surrogate so that its gradient direction points toward improvements in the true objective, even if the surface looks different. This requires mathematical care, ensuring that the surrogate is not only differentiable but also interpretable enough to trust during model updates.
ADVERTISEMENT
ADVERTISEMENT
Beyond alignment, calibration is essential to prevent overconfidence in the surrogate's signals. Calibration involves adjusting scales, offsets, and loss weightings so that the surrogate’s outputs reflect plausible margins for real-world consequences. For example, in classification tasks, a surrogate may emphasize margin maximization, but the actual utility might hinge on calibrated probabilities and risk thresholds. Practitioners often incorporate temperature scaling, isotonic regression, or threshold tuning as part of a broader calibration protocol. Rigorous calibration guards against optimistic performance estimates and helps ensure that improvements observed in surrogate metrics translate into tangible gains, especially under distribution shift.
Practical steps to implement principled surrogate choices.
Robustness under distributional shifts is a key concern when using surrogate losses. Real-world data evolve, and a surrogate needs to maintain its effectiveness without retraining from scratch. Techniques such as regularization, margin damping, and conservative updates help stabilize learning. Additionally, incorporating domain knowledge into the surrogate structure can prevent the model from exploiting incidental patterns that do not generalize. Practitioners should test surrogates across diverse scenarios, including adversarial settings and varying sample sizes, to observe how the surrogate responds when the original objective becomes noisier or more complex. A well-constructed surrogate remains reliable even as data characteristics change.
ADVERTISEMENT
ADVERTISEMENT
Exploration of the surrogate's biases is an ongoing discipline. Any proxy inevitably introduces biases that reflect the proxy’s design choices. To limit unintended consequences, teams implement diagnostics that reveal systematic deviations from the intended objective. Cumulative performance tracking, ablation studies, and stability metrics help detect when improvements on the surrogate no longer yield desired results. If bias concerns arise, adjustments such as reweighting samples, modifying loss components, or introducing constraint terms can rebalance the optimization. The aim is to keep the surrogate honest about what it optimizes, preserving alignment with the ultimate success criteria.
Aligning surrogate design with organizational goals and ethics.
A practical approach starts with problem framing, where stakeholders, data scientists, and domain experts converge on the essential outcome. This shared understanding informs the construction of a surrogate that captures the objective’s core signals while discarding extraneous complexity. The next step is iterative prototyping: build a candidate surrogate, test with synthetic and real data, and refine based on observed gaps. Documentation is essential at every stage, detailing assumptions, the rationale for chosen components, and the expected impact on the true objective. This transparency aids peer review and ensures accountability for how surrogate decisions shape model behavior over time.
Prototyping should be complemented by a rigorous evaluation protocol that goes beyond training performance. Evaluate surrogates on held-out data, stress-test them with edge cases, and compare against baselines that directly optimize simpler proxies or surrogate-free objectives when feasible. Visualization of loss landscapes, gradient directions, and decision boundaries can reveal hidden pitfalls, such as flat regions or misaligned gradients. The ultimate test is whether incremental improvements on the surrogate translate into meaningful improvements in the final measure of interest, across a spectrum of realistic scenarios and operational constraints.
ADVERTISEMENT
ADVERTISEMENT
Bridges between theory, practice, and continuous improvement.
Surrogate loss design intersects with operational realities, including latency budgets, hardware limits, and team workflows. A surrogate that promises theoretical gains but imposes prohibitive computational costs defeats its purpose. Therefore, practitioners look for lightweight surrogates that leverage efficient approximations, such as low-rank representations, sketching, or incremental updates. These techniques preserve essential signal properties while keeping resource use within acceptable bounds. When possible, practitioners exploit parallelism and hardware acceleration to maintain throughput. The goal is to achieve a practical balance where the surrogate can be deployed reliably in production environments without sacrificing trust or fairness.
Ethical considerations must accompany surrogate-based optimization, especially in high-stakes domains. Surrogates can inadvertently amplify biases or obscure harms if not carefully monitored. Designers should embed fairness-aware constraints, robust testing against disparate subgroups, and transparent reporting about surrogate behavior under diverse conditions. Regular auditing, external validation, and clear governance protocols help ensure that surrogate-driven optimization aligns with societal values and organizational commitments. By foregrounding ethics, teams prevent optimization prowess from outpacing accountability, preserving public trust and model legitimacy.
Theoretical foundations illuminate why a surrogate may perform well in a controlled setting but falter in practice. Bounds on approximation error, convergence guarantees, and stability analyses guide expectations and risk assessment. In parallel, practitioners must stay agile, adapting surrogates as new data arrive and objectives evolve. A culture of continuous learning—featuring retrospectives, post-deployment monitoring, and retraining triggers—helps ensure that surrogate methods remain aligned with current needs. By integrating theory with practical feedback loops, teams cultivate surrogate strategies that endure, resisting obsolescence as environments shift and requirements change.
In summary, surrogate loss functions offer a disciplined path to tackle complex objectives while preserving optimization tractability. The most effective surrogates balance fidelity to the target metric with computational efficiency, incorporate calibration and bias checks, and stay robust to shifts in data and demands. A holistic implementation embraces rigorous evaluation, ethical safeguards, and ongoing refinement. When these principles are followed, surrogate-based optimization yields reliable, scalable performance that supports informed decision making without sacrificing rigor or control. Continuous learning and transparent reporting underpin long-term success in deploying surrogate-driven models across domains.
Related Articles
Machine learning
Personalization pipelines must adapt when user histories are sparse or unavailable, leveraging cross-user signals, contextual cues, and simulation-based training to achieve stable performance. This evergreen overview outlines practical approaches to design, evaluation, and deployment that reduce cold start risk while preserving user-centric relevance, privacy, and scalability across domains.
-
July 30, 2025
Machine learning
A practical, evergreen guide exploring how multi-objective Bayesian optimization harmonizes accuracy, latency, and resource constraints, enabling data scientists to systematically balance competing model requirements across diverse deployment contexts.
-
July 21, 2025
Machine learning
This evergreen guide presents a principled approach to building surrogate models that illuminate opaque machine learning systems, balancing fidelity, simplicity, and practical usefulness for stakeholders seeking trustworthy predictions and transparent reasoning.
-
July 15, 2025
Machine learning
This evergreen guide explains practical strategies to design and deploy multitask learning systems that efficiently leverage shared representations across related predictive tasks while preserving task-specific accuracy and interpretability.
-
July 19, 2025
Machine learning
Designing robust cross modality retrieval demands thoughtful alignment of heterogeneous representations, scalable indexing, and rigorous evaluation. This article outlines enduring guidelines for building systems that cohesively fuse text, image, and audio signals into a unified retrieval experience.
-
August 09, 2025
Machine learning
Crafting concise explainers blends clarity, relevance, and guided actions, enabling users to understand algorithmic choices quickly, connect them to practical outcomes, and confidently apply suggested next steps without technical jargon.
-
July 29, 2025
Machine learning
Robust human in the loop pipelines blend thoughtful process design, continuous feedback, and scalable automation to lift label quality, reduce drift, and sustain model performance across evolving data landscapes.
-
July 18, 2025
Machine learning
This guide explains how to build resilient checkpoint ensembles by combining models saved at diverse training stages, detailing practical strategies to improve predictive stability, reduce overfitting, and enhance generalization across unseen data domains through thoughtful design and evaluation.
-
July 23, 2025
Machine learning
This evergreen guide examines a practical framework for merging reinforcement learning with traditional control theory, detailing integration strategies, stability considerations, real‑world deployment, safety measures, and long‑term adaptability across diverse industrial settings.
-
August 02, 2025
Machine learning
This evergreen guide explains how continuous feature drift monitoring can inform timely retraining decisions, balancing performance, cost, and resilience while outlining practical, scalable workflows for real-world deployments.
-
July 15, 2025
Machine learning
This evergreen guide explores how causal constraints can be embedded into supervised learning, detailing practical strategies, theoretical underpinnings, and real-world examples that reduce spurious correlations and improve model reliability.
-
July 18, 2025
Machine learning
Transparent evaluation reports require disciplined structure, clear metrics, audible explanations, and governance practices that align fairness, reliability, and risk oversight across diverse stakeholders.
-
July 18, 2025
Machine learning
Calibration drift is a persistent challenge for probabilistic models; this guide outlines practical measurement methods, monitoring strategies, and mitigation techniques to maintain reliable probabilities despite evolving data and periodic model updates.
-
July 29, 2025
Machine learning
A practical exploration of modular explainability toolkits, detailing architectures, design principles, and deployment strategies that accommodate diverse model families and varied user proficiency without sacrificing clarity or reliability.
-
July 21, 2025
Machine learning
Designing robust multimodal captioning and grounding systems requires disciplined adherence to data provenance, alignment verification, uncertainty management, and continuous evaluation across diverse visual domains and linguistic styles.
-
July 30, 2025
Machine learning
As domains evolve, continual pretraining offers practical pathways to refresh large language models, enabling them to assimilate new terminology, jargon, and evolving concepts without starting from scratch, thus preserving learned general capabilities while improving domain accuracy and usefulness.
-
August 07, 2025
Machine learning
A practical overview guides data scientists through selecting resilient metrics, applying cross validation thoughtfully, and interpreting results across diverse datasets to prevent overfitting and misjudgment in real-world deployments.
-
August 09, 2025
Machine learning
Efficient feature selection balances simplicity and accuracy, guiding data scientists to prune redundant inputs while preserving essential signal, enabling robust models, faster insights, and resilient deployments across diverse domains.
-
August 04, 2025
Machine learning
This evergreen guide explores modular design strategies that decouple model components, enabling targeted testing, straightforward replacement, and transparent reasoning throughout complex data analytics pipelines.
-
July 30, 2025
Machine learning
This evergreen guide explores principled strategies for building cross domain evaluation suites that assess generalization, reveal hidden biases, and guide the development of models capable of performing reliably beyond their training domains.
-
August 08, 2025